The knowledge of historical solar activity is of great interest. The present work analyses descriptions of the solar corona observed during the eclipse of 24 June 1778. The corona was described as showing streamers at all solar latitudes. The descriptions are indicative of a high level of solar activity, in concordance with historical sunspot number data.
